A body is moving under the action of two force `vec(F_(1)=2hati-5hatj` , `vec(F_(2)=3hati-4hatj` . Its velocity will become uniform under a third force `vec(F_(3)` given by.

A

`5hati-9hatj`

B

`-5hati-9hatj`

C

`5hati+9hatj`

D

`-5hati+9hatj`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
D
